Diagoras (LGRP / RHO)

Rodes Island, Dodecanese, Greece, GRC

Iraklion Nikos Kazantzakis (LGIR / HER)

Heraklion, Irakleion, Greece, GRC

<

Sat, 5 Apr '25

>

🛫 Flights